## Deploying Fanfare

Heads up: Fanfare's fan-out workers will happily flood downstream push gateways unless backpressure is tuned. Deploy with the rate limiter enabled — always. If subscribers lag, the buffer drains to disk instead of dropping. Roll one region at a time and watch the queue-depth dashboard. Ship with these configuration values.

service settings:
[casax]
port = 6379
team = rusir
host = casax.zemvarhq.corp
region = outer-4
access_code = ac_9808ce
timeout_ms = 1500

Runbook section 7 — Permit blueprint dispatch, Corvane Heights project. The shift lead verifies that the blueprint tube is capped at both ends, labeled with the permit application title, and matched against the outbound manifest before release. Only the assigned courier may take custody, and the transfer must be witnessed and initialed by a second warehouse staff member. Once verified, relay the hand-over instruction recorded below.

handover note for yagef-bagep: the drudor pelius courier leaves the kasdor zorvan norir ledger at gate 8016 under passcode 755406

## Local Setup

Before running the Lanternjack workflow engine locally, stop any leftover cron entries from the old scheduler — duplicate runs will corrupt the job ledger. Install the CLI with `make tools`, then start the engine via `lanternjack up --dev`. If a migrated job stalls, check worker logs first. Point your dev instance at the jobs database using the string below.

primary connection of yagep-kahip = redis://giliel_svc:zYiKsLL2PLpfPL@db-348f.xolmarsys.corp:5432/fenwyn

**Hardware Lab Access — Assistants**

The Brindlewood hardware lab (Level 3, east wing) is badge-restricted. Assistants escorting deliveries may enter without an engineer present, but must sign the wall log and keep the door closed behind them. Loan equipment stays inside the lab. For the keypad by the freight entrance, use the following code.

turnstile pass: bdg-QZV-3